dlr 2005/05/10 11:58:45
Modified: src/test/org/apache/xmlrpc XmlWriterTest.java
Log:
* src/test/org/apache/xmlrpc/XmlWriterTest.java
(testWriter): Added missing outer <value> elements to wrap expected
output from <array> and <struct> tests added in previous commits.
Target release: 2.0
Revision Changes Path
1.10 +5 -5 ws-xmlrpc/src/test/org/apache/xmlrpc/XmlWriterTest.java
Index: XmlWriterTest.java
===================================================================
RCS file: /home/cvs/ws-xmlrpc/src/test/org/apache/xmlrpc/XmlWriterTest.java,v
retrieving revision 1.9
retrieving revision 1.10
diff -u -u -r1.9 -r1.10
--- XmlWriterTest.java 10 May 2005 18:47:12 -0000 1.9
+++ XmlWriterTest.java 10 May 2005 18:58:45 -0000 1.10
@@ -90,20 +90,20 @@
Object[] array = { foobar, thirtySeven };
writer.writeObject(array);
writer.flush();
- postProlog += "<array><data>";
+ postProlog += "<value><array><data>";
postProlog += "<value>" + foobar + "</value>";
postProlog += "<value><int>" + thirtySeven + "</int></value>";
- postProlog += "</data></array>";
+ postProlog += "</data></array></value>";
assertTrue(buffer.toString().endsWith(postProlog));
Hashtable map = new Hashtable();
map.put(foobar, thirtySeven);
writer.writeObject(map);
writer.flush();
- postProlog += "<struct><member>";
+ postProlog += "<value><struct><member>";
postProlog += "<name>" + foobar + "</name>";
postProlog += "<value><int>" + thirtySeven + "</int></value>";
- postProlog += "</member></struct>";
+ postProlog += "</member></struct></value>";
assertTrue(buffer.toString().endsWith(postProlog));
}
catch (Exception e)